site stats

React atom state

WebYou can compare the new state against expected values using this pattern. It uses a React functional component, useRecoilValue and useEffect, to observe an atom / selector 's changes and execute a callback every time the user performs an action that modifies the state. export const RecoilObserver = ({node, onChange}) => { WebNov 8, 2024 · Atoms are units of state. They're updateable and subscribable: when an atom is updated, each subscribed component is re-rendered with the new value. An atom represents a piece of state that you can read and update anywhere in your application. Think of it as a useState that can be shared in any component.

Understand Recoil in React - Telerik Blogs

WebOct 17, 2024 · Recoil is backed by Facebook and used in some of its applications, and has brought an entirely new approach to sharing state in React. I’m sure that even if Recoil is deprecated, another tool that follows the same path, like Jotai, will gain traction. Recoil is built on top of two terms: atom and selector. An atom is a shared-state piece. WebJotai takes an atomic approach to global React state management with a model inspired by Recoil. Build state by combining atoms and renders are automatically optimized based on atom dependency. This solves the extra re-render issue of React context and eliminates … There are two kinds of atoms: a writable atom and a read-only atom. Primitive … ina section 101 a 15 k https://swrenovators.com

Jotai vs. Recoil: What are the differences? - LogRocket Blog

WebMar 21, 2024 · The state is an object that holds information about a certain component. Plain JavaScript functions don't have the ability to store information. The code within them executes and "dissapears" once the execution is finished. But thanks to state, React functional components can store information even after execution. WebDec 6, 2024 · Manage state in your React application using Recoil. Have an understanding of Recoil atoms and selectors. Getting started. Before we get started, we need to familiarize ourselves with the following terms: An atom - An atom is a piece of state. We can import an atom into our components, which allows us to use and update it from our component. Webreact app best practice atom_symbol_selector React Redux应用示例包含所有最佳实践源码. ReactRedux示例 描述 使用引导的React应用程序与REST API和一起使用以进行状态管理。 由功能优先模式拆分的组件和特定于redux的代码(归约器,操作,操作类型)。 ina section 101 a 20

Multiple form values in one react recoil atom override each other

Category:atomFamily(options) Recoil

Tags:React atom state

React atom state

Top 5 react-atom-fork Code Examples Snyk

WebNov 12, 2024 · Your atom has a single value register holds an array at the beginning, and later be assigned with the values of the inputs. Both input s set the state of the atom registerAtom, makes it override each other. What you need to do is holding an object as a value for register, that has two keys: email and phone. WebNov 29, 2024 · React developers usually use two approaches to organize application state, component state (useState) and global store (Redux). Accordingly, the state can live in …

React atom state

Did you know?

WebApr 5, 2024 · So React added the concept of State. Introduction to State in React. State allows us to manage changing data in an application. It's defined as an object where we define key-value pairs specifying various data we want to track in the application. In React, all the code we write is defined inside a component. WebApr 22, 2024 · React Atom for State Management - YouTube. Today I try out react-atom a clojurescript inspired state management library created by Derrick Beining------Social …

WebThere are two kinds of atoms: a writable atom and a read-only atom. Primitive atoms are always writable. Derived atoms are writable if the write is specified. The write of primitive atoms is equivalent to the setState of React.useState.. debugLabel property. The created atom config can have an optional property debugLabel.The debug label is used to display … WebInstructor. jotai is a primitive and flexible state management solution for React. jotai gives you a minimalistic API that you can use that separates your state management from your UI. You get the benefits of well manages state AND you don't have to set up any boilerplate like defining actions, reducers, dispatchers, or stores.

WebApr 22, 2024 · React Atom for State Management - YouTube Today I try out react-atom a clojurescript inspired state management library created by Derrick Beining------Social LinksGitHub -... WebSep 8, 2024 · An atom is a changeable, subscribable unit of the state. Imagine atoms as a local React state, which any component can subscribe to. Atoms are updatable and …

WebSep 8, 2024 · An atom is a changeable, subscribable unit of the state. Imagine atoms as a local React state, which any component can subscribe to. Atoms are updatable and subscribable, and changing the value of an atom will re-render every component that’s subscribed to that specific atom.

WebJan 6, 2024 · The atomic state is much closer to the React state and stored inside the React tree (flux and proxy store data outside of it and could be used without React). That’s why … ina section 101 a 43 nWebAn atom represents a piece of state. Atoms can be read from and written to from any component. Components that read the value of an atom are implicitly subscribed to that … ina section 101 a 15 bWebJun 25, 2024 · In this example, every state object key could be referred to as an atom. Atoms represent a piece of state, i.e., key1, key2, and key3. Let’s create an atom to hold the count state variable. // Note the import 👇 import { atom } from "recoil"; // creating the state value const count = atom({ key: "count", default: 0 }); incepta head officeWebSep 9, 2024 · State in React is a JavaScript object that can change the behavior of a component as a result of a user’s action. States can also be thought of as a component’s … ina section 101 fWebSep 9, 2024 · First, let’s discuss the importance of state management. State in React is a JavaScript object that can change the behavior of a component as a result of a user’s action. States can also be thought of as a component’s memory. React apps are built with components that manage their own state. This works OK for small apps, but as the app ... incepta insurance brokersWebFeb 23, 2024 · // Fetch the global state from recoil to be used within the component const [entries, setEntries] = useRecoilState (entriesObject); I take redux as a reference because it never resets the state unless you do it inside the reducer by yourself but now I see that the state -somehow- resets for no reason. Can anyone help with this? Thanks in advance. ina section 101 b 1 fWebJan 2, 2024 · It's also possible to pass a function with the signature function (state, props) => newState. This enqueues an atomic update that consults the previous value of state … ina section 101 f 6